Korean Beef and Spicy Mayo Stir-Fry

Another quick and easy meal from Blue Apron. It took me about twenty minutes to whip up this meal up.

  • 10 oz Thinly Sliced Beef
  • ½ cup Jasmine or Brown Rice (prepare according to directions)
  • 3 oz Radishes
  • 4 cloves Garlic
  • 4 oz Snow Peas (cut off the ends)
  • 1 Tbsp Light Brown Sugar
  • 1 Tbsp Soy Sauce
  • ¼ cup Cornstarch
  • 2 Tbsps Mayonnaise
  • 1 Tbsp Sesame Oil or Olive Oil
  • 1 Tbsp Rice Vinegar
  • 2 tsps Gochujang

**I also added onion, green pepper, and fish sauce.

Directions:

Rinse and pat dry the beef pieces. Pour cornstarch in a bowl and add salt, pepper and any other seasonings you like. Coat all the pieces in the cornstarch. Heat up oil in a pan, and make sure it’s really hot. Put the pieces flat on the pan and let them cook about two minutes on each side.

Remove the meat and add the sliced vegetables and stir fry. Meantime, put the fish sauce, brown sugar, soy sauce, and any other seasonings you like in a bowl and mix. Add the meat back to the vegetables, pour on the sauce on the beef and vegetables and stir-fry for about two minutes.
